> One lesson to learn from all of this (besides the several about
> backups, image persistence, etc.) is to make sure that changes go into
> the test image and are snapshotted. I am sure there are things we
> lost from the original image because they were not put into the test
> bed. The test bed ought to be an accurate reflection of the real
> image plus the addition of our development and testing efforts.
>
Yes, this all sounds like good ideas to we have to adopt.
I guess we will discover more stuff along the way.
The test image should be kept in sync, but will sometimes contain
experimental code
so it's not a real backup.
